 The Syrian Orthodox Church
The Syrian Orthodox Church is one of the five so-called monophysite churches, characterised by their rejection of the Council of Chalcedon.
In contrast to Chalcedon's doctrine that Christ is one person existing in two natures the Syrian Orthodox Church affirms that Christ's humanity cannot be separated from his divinity.
In the 4th and 5th centuries relations between the church in Syria and the Byzantine church deteriorated in the face of growing Byzantine domination.

 Syrian Orthodox Church
The Syrian Orthodox Church uses the Antiochene liturgy, and performs it in Syriac, which is a language close to Aramaic, the language Jesus spoke.
1930: The Syrian Orthodox Church of Kerala, India, splits from its main church in Syria, and joins the Roman Catholic Church as The Malankarese Catholic Church.
Independent Christian church of the Middle East, also known as Jacobite Church.

 Syrian Church
In 1665, the Antiochian church came into contact with the ancient church of St Thomas Christians in India, and the West Syrian liturgy was thus introduced to the Christians in South India.
Though the Syrian church is vastly reduced in number because of Muslim domination, it has a considerable diaspora in the US, Australia and Europe.
The Syrian Orthodox Church traces its history to A.D. 37 and holds the traditions of St Peter's work.

 The Development of the Canon of the New Testament - Peshitta
By the beginning of the 5th century, or slightly earlier, the Syrian Church's version of the Bible, the Peshitta ('simple' translation) was formed.
Among the Western Syrians, however, there were closer ties with their neighboring Churches, and a further accommodation with the Roman church took place in the 6th-7th centuries when the Philoxenian and Harclean versions of the Peshitta were issued containing all 27 New Testament books.
For the eastern part of the Syrian Church this constituted the closing of the canon, for after the Council of Ephesus (431 CE) the East Syrians separated themselves as the Nestorians.

 Syrian Catholic Church
Semi-autonomous Christian church, which is affiliated to the Roman Catholic Church through the Eastern Rite.
By this, the Syrian branch is allowed to retain its customs and rites, even when these differ from the traditions of the Roman church.
13th century: Attempts from the Catholic Church to make a reconciliation with the Syrian Orthodox Church.
